    Abstract:
    Type III KGd(PO3)(4) and Nd:KGd(PO3)(4) single crystals have been successfully grown. We have proved that these crystals have a wide transparency window closing at 160 nm in the UV region and extending to 4 mu m in the IR region. We have determined that a slight rotation occurred for the dielectric frame in the 355-1064 nm range of wavelengths. We have measured the absorption in the I-4(9/2) -> F-4(5/2) channel and the emission in the F-4(3/2) -> I-4(11/2) channel. In addition to the three N-p, N-m, N-g usual polarizations, a fourth spectroscopic parameter representing the framework rotation of the linear polarization imaginary part around the N-p axis was needed for a full description. Lasing was obtained at 1052.4 nm in N-p polarization (ordinary wave) for propagation in the N-g - N-m principal plane.
